<p>Bengaluru: Samarthanam Trust for the Disabled, in partnership with OpenText, will host the 18th Annual Bengaluru Walkathon on Saturday at Kittur Rani Chennamma Stadium, Jayanagar 3rd Block. The event will commence at 9 am.</p>.<p>The announcement was made during a press meet on Wednesday by Manoj Nagpal, Managing Director of OpenText India, and Dr Mahantesh G Kivadasannavar, Founder-Trustee of Samarthanam Trust and Chairman of the Cricket Association for the Blind in India (CABI). The duo also unveiled the official T-shirt for the walkathon.</p>.<p>The walkathon, held annually to mark World Disability Day on December 3, is themed ‘Health for All’ this year. It aims to promote inclusivity and equal opportunities for people of all abilities, raise awareness about disabilities, encourage healthier lifestyles, and advocate for equitable access to healthcare.</p>
